Disney+ revealed yesterday that the Disney and Pixar movies Lightyear – The True Story of Buzz comes streaming on August 3, 2022: confirmation for our country arrives today, along with a message from director Angus MacLane.

Lightyear – Buzz’s True Story is obviously great on the big screen, but we’re excited to bring it to Disney+. We have devoted years of our lives to this film and we are very proud of it. We want to share it with as wide an audience as possible. Disney+ not only gives more fans the opportunity to see Lightyear – Buzz’s True Story, but also allows us all to watch it whenever we want.

New Disney & Pixar Lightyear Adventure – Buzz’s True Story tells the origin of Buzz Lightyear, the hero who inspired the Toy Story toys, and follows the legendary Space Ranger after he becomes trapped on a hostile planet 4.2 million light-years from the earth, along with his commander and their crew. As Buzz tries to find his way home through time and space, he is joined by a group of ambitious recruits and his irresistible companion, robot cat, Sox. The arrival of Zurg, a massive presence with an army of ruthless robots and a mysterious ending, complicates matters and jeopardizes the mission.

Lightyear – Buzz’s True Story is directed by Angus MacLane (co-director of Finding Dory) and produced by Galyn Susman (Toy Story: Another World). The film’s soundtrack is autographed by award-winning composer Michael Giacchino (The Batman, Up).

In the Italian version of the film, Alberto Boubakar Malanchino (Buzz Lightyear), Ludovico Tersigni (Sox), Esther Elisha (Alisha Hawthorne) and Linda Raimondo who plays a cameo borrow their voices. In addition, Scuderia Ferrari drivers Charles Leclerc and Carlos Sainz make cameos in the Italian and Spanish versions of the film, respectively.
